Renowned author Paul Auster passes away at the age of 77, known for ‘The New York Trilogy’ and ‘4 3 2 1’

Paul Auster, a renowned writer and filmmaker known for his inventive narratives, died at 77 after a battle with cancer. Over his career, which spanned from the 1970s until his passing, Auster completed more than 30 books that were translated into multiple languages. While he didn’t achieve significant commercial success in the U.S., he was highly esteemed overseas for his erudite and introspective style. Auster’s work was known for blending history, politics, genre experiments, existential quests, and self-referential elements to writers and writing.

One of Auster’s most prominent works was his “The New York Trilogy,” consisting of “City of Glass,” “Ghosts,” and “The Locked Room,” which delved into postmodern detective stories with blurred identities and a protagonist named Paul Auster. His longest novel, “4 3 2 1,” published in 2017 and a Booker finalist, was an 800-plus page exploration of quadraphonic realism in the post-World War II era. Across his career, Auster delved into various genres and formats, including nonfiction compilations, family memoirs, biographies, novels, and poetry collections.

In addition to his literary career, Auster also had a successful film career, collaborating on acclaimed projects like “Smoke” and “Blue in the Face” with director Wayne Wang. Auster also directed films himself, including “Lulu on the Bridge” and “The Inner Life of Martin Frost.” His ability to work closely with actors was informed by his belief that there was a similarity between writing fiction and acting, with writers operating through words on a page while actors used their bodies to convey a story.

Personal tragedy struck Auster when his son, Daniel, died in 2022 from a drug overdose shortly after being charged with second-degree manslaughter in the death of his infant daughter, Ruby. Auster, who had written extensively about parenthood, never publicly commented on his son’s death. Despite the personal challenges he faced, Auster continued to create thought-provoking and complex narratives that captivated readers and critics alike throughout his career.

Born in Newark, New Jersey, Auster grew up in a middle-class Jewish household that influenced his perspective on materialism and inspired his thirst for literature and art. Despite the challenges he faced in his early career, Auster remained committed to his passion for writing and never wavered in his pursuit of becoming a writer. His dedication to his craft, alongside his distinctive writing style and thematic explorations, solidified his legacy as one of the most influential and celebrated writers of his generation.
